Subject: ADD: I Thought I Had No Voice (Scott Murray)
This song really deserves a place in a list of great chorus songs, but maybe you don't know it yet.
Scott Murray sang for us in the Rolling Hills Folk Club last November. His song was recorded by Roy Bailey and you can see/hear him on YTube.
I Thought I had no Voice by Scott Murray 2012
